Local Laws Overview

In Iasi, Romania, Employment Rights are primarily governed by the Labor Code and other relevant legislation. Key aspects of local laws include minimum wage requirements, working hours regulations, vacation entitlements, maternity and paternity leave rights, and protection against discrimination and harassment in the workplace.

2. Can my employer terminate my contract without a valid reason?

No, your employer cannot terminate your contract without a valid reason as per the Labor Code. If you believe you have been wrongfully terminated, you may seek legal assistance to protect your rights.

3. What should I do if I am facing discrimination or harassment at work?

If you are facing discrimination or harassment at work, you should document the incidents, report them to your HR department, and seek legal advice immediately. Your employer is obligated to provide a safe and inclusive work environment.

4. Are there any restrictions on working hours in Iasi, Romania?

Yes, there are restrictions on working hours in Iasi, Romania. Employees are generally entitled to a maximum number of working hours per week, with overtime pay for any additional hours worked.

5. Do I have the right to maternity or paternity leave in Iasi, Romania?

Yes, employees in Iasi, Romania have the right to maternity and paternity leave as per the Labor Code. You are entitled to a certain amount of paid leave before and after the birth of a child.

Additional Resources

If you require legal assistance with your Employment Rights in Iasi, Romania, you may contact the National Council for Combating Discrimination or the Romanian General Confederation of Labour for guidance and support.
